{CLICK HERE TO DOWNLOAD WALK AS A PDF}This is a vigorous walk built around the only officially designated stairs in Silver Lake, the famous location where Laurel and Hardy made their 1932 Academy Award-winning short The Music Box for producer Hal Roach. The two comedians had to carry a piano up the steep flight of steps between Vendome Street and Descanso Drive. All you have to do is walk it—once up, once down—and conquer the surrounding hills.
